Voir le résumé
La vie artificielle recouvre un ensemble de réalisations principalement informatiques et robotiques tentant d'incarner dans un matériel non biochimique les processus inhérents au vivant. Parmi ces processus on retrouve des fonctionnalités dites " émergentes ", des processus d'interactions sensori-moteurs avec l'environnement, et des mécanismes évolutifs soit " d'apprentissage " soit " néo-Darwinien ". Sa finalité est triple, d'abord offrir aux biologistes ou chimistes des environnements informatiques qu'ils pourraient facilement paramétrer de manière à simuler les processus naturels qu'ils étudient. Ensuite découvrir de nouvelles lois comportementales propres à ces systèmes à un niveau d'abstraction tel que ces lois s'appliqueraient à un ensemble de systèmes biologiques, par exemple le nombre d'attracteurs comme une fonction du nombre d'unités composant ces systèmes, la tendance intrinsèque à faire émerger des sous-systèmes auto-maintenus ou finalement l'incroyable complexité qui peut apparaître à un certain niveau d'observation de ces systèmes alors qu'au niveau juste en-dessous les mécanismes décrits sont élémentaires. Finalement la nature ayant toujours inspiré l'ingénieur, la dernière motivation est l'apprentissage de nouvelles méthodologies pour la conception d'artefacts de type robotique ou informatique. Généralement, là encore, l'idée est d'utiliser l'informatique pour sa force brute et sa capacité intrinsèque à essayer en un minimum de temps des combinaisons quasi infinies de possibles solutions à un problème, jusqu'à trouver malgré la simplicité de la procédure une solution complexe et inattendue à ce problème. Quelques exemples d'applications comme des robots autonomes, des systèmes de routage sur Internet (inspiré des fourmis), des protections informatiques (inspiré du système immunitaire) seront illustrés.
Mot(s) clés libre(s) : apprentissage, émergence, interaction avec l'environnement, mécanisme biologique, modélisation, réseaux neuronaux, robotique, simulation, systèmes complexes, vie artificielle